Cash-strapped Peugeot Automobile Nigeria, has said that it leave shortly commence importation of use cars into the country in a move to shore up its tax income profile. The companys Managing Director, Dr. Haroun Aliyu, said at a news conference held at the ongoing Kaduna foreign Trade Fair that since Nigeria has a large market for secondment hand vehicles, there was nothing upon if PAN imported and certified such vehicles for the use of Nigerians. Justifying the companys new direction, the PAN stomp said that the vehicles to be imported would be certified by the manufacturers, who would withal make available the slender history of the vehicles to prospective buyers, even as he argued that, even in Europe, people patronise used vehicles more than the brand new ones.If ownership of Tokunbo cars is the problem of Nigerians, we have plans to bring what we call certified second hand vehicles. It is good as it is done globally and not the road-side Tokunbo market that we have wher e you do not have the history of the vehicle. The certified second hand cars, which we are working on to see how we will launch it in Nigeria is for us to bring in cars that are used, but are recertified by the manufacturers, with a label. If you buy a car with a label from any of the networks, it is as good as purchasing a new car because you have access to all the information as well as all the history of the vehicle and you can be supported by the brand, he said. He also lamented that government had not been encouraging local automobile manufacturers.
